E-Plus To Launch Airflash Location-Based Services To 6 Million German Mobile Customers
URL(s): E-Plus
CeBIT 2001, HANNOVER, GERMANY-March 21, 2001-E-Plus Mobilfunk GmbH & Co. KG and AirFlash, Inc., the premier development platform provider for building location-based wireless applications, today announced their intention to work together to deliver location-based services to E-Plus customers using the AirFlash(tm) SmartZone(tm) platform. Starting in June 2001, E-Plus will offer these popular context-relevant applications for WAP and SMS to their 6 million mobile customers. E-Plus will showcase its new services during the CeBIT 2001 trade fair in Hannover, Germany, March 22-28.
E-Plus will offer a variety of lifestyle-relevant services to its customers in Germany; all hosted on the AirFlash SmartZone platform. These will include basic search-save services such as business listings search, driving directions and walking directions as well as AirFlash's signature push-pull viral community applications. E-Plus will also use the AirFlash SmartZone platform to develop and deploy its own brand of location-based services specifically targeted to E-Plus business, mainstream, and teen mobile customers.
